如何修改MySQL用户密码

简介

MySQL是一款常用的关系型数据库管理系统,通过修改用户密码可以保证数据库的安全性。本文将介绍修改MySQL用户root密码的流程,并提供具体的代码示例。

修改密码流程

下表展示了修改MySQL用户root密码的步骤:

步骤 描述
步骤一 连接到MySQL服务器
步骤二 选择要使用的数据库
步骤三 修改root用户密码

接下来,我们将详细介绍每一步需要做什么,以及提供相应的代码示例。

步骤一:连接到MySQL服务器

首先,我们需要使用MySQL的命令行工具或者任何支持MySQL的GUI工具连接到MySQL服务器。在命令行中,可以使用以下命令连接到MySQL服务器:

mysql -u root -p

该命令将提示输入密码,输入正确的密码后即可成功连接到MySQL服务器。

步骤二:选择要使用的数据库

成功连接到MySQL服务器后,我们需要选择要使用的数据库。可以使用以下命令选择数据库:

use mysql;

该命令将切换当前会话的数据库为mysql,这是MySQL内置的一个系统数据库,其中包含了用户权限相关的表格。

步骤三:修改root用户密码

在选择了正确的数据库之后,我们可以执行以下命令来修改root用户的密码:

UPDATE user SET authentication_string=PASSWORD('新密码') WHERE user='root';

上述代码中的新密码需要替换为你想要设置的新密码。该命令将更新user表格中root用户的authentication_string字段,使其值为经过加密的新密码。

完整代码示例

下面是完整的代码示例,展示了如何修改MySQL用户root的密码:

-- 连接到MySQL服务器
mysql -u root -p

-- 选择要使用的数据库
use mysql;

-- 修改root用户密码
UPDATE user SET authentication_string=PASSWORD('新密码') WHERE user='root';

请注意,上述代码示例中的新密码需要替换为你想要设置的新密码。

序列图

下面是修改MySQL用户root密码的序列图:

sequenceDiagram
    participant 开发者
    participant 小白
    开发者->>小白: 告知修改密码流程
    开发者->>小白: 提供代码示例
    小白->>开发者: 请求帮助
    开发者->>小白: 详细解释每一步的操作
    小白->>开发者: 修改密码完成

以上就是修改MySQL用户root密码的完整流程和相应的代码示例。通过按照上述步骤操作,你将能够成功修改MySQL用户root的密码。希望本文能对你有所帮助!